Description

In this episode of Intelligence Matters, host Michael Morell speaks with Michael Bennet, U.S. Senator from Colorado and a current Democratic presidential candidate. Morell and Bennet discuss the state of American politics and the ideologies and objectives that would define a Bennet administration. Bennet, who was recently added to the Senate Intelligence Committee, discusses the state of U.S. election security and his priorities for confronting Russia, China, Iran and North Korea.
